APPLES IN STEREO


I'm sure everybody is in love with Apples In Stereo right now. They've just rolled out their sixth album of amazing pop songs, and with Elijah Wood's money behind them, it looks as though a broader audience may be waiting in the wings for them. I'm mostly infatuated with them because a rare recent sunny day revealed New Magnetic Wonder to me as perhaps their best album, and they will be playing their first Irish show in May.

Also, I've just found a 4-part "making of" the album on youtube (part 1 is here and the others are alongside it) and hence I've just discovered exactly how friendly, funny, excited, talented and plain old nice a man that Robert Schneider is. The video of the band miming along to Same Old Drag on their van's stereo is also worth a look.

TAXI, TAXI!


There's something about that picture that says a lot about Taxi, Taxi.

If the people in the photograph were of the same age (17) but male, you could almost be positive that their music would be rubbish. Maybe they'd make boring bedsit strums about losing women and living in a lonely bedsit. But no, thankfully! They are two Swedish girls - identical twin sisters - and their songs are as well-crafted and beautiful as any output you'd expect from pretty girls who slave over a guitar and typewriter instead of doing their homework.

Now labelmates with the likes of Grizzly Bear and Cacoy at Rumraket Records, they'll be releasing an EP soon, sure to be stuffed with more wintery yet warm love songs, laden with ukulele, synth and handclaps.
